IPTorrents (IPT) offers a specialized IPTV service primarily as a perk for its private tracker community. While often considered a "best-kept secret" among members, its performance and setup differ significantly from mainstream providers. Service Overview & Performance
The service is generally regarded as highly reliable with a vast channel list. Unlike many commercial IPTV providers that suffer from frequent buffering during major events, IPT's streams are noted for their stability.
Content Library: Includes a comprehensive selection of global live TV and sports.
Quality: Streams are optimized for high-bitrate performance (H264/H265), though users have noted that the default Electronic Program Guide (EPG) can be unreliable.
Stability: It is often cited for having minimal buffering even during peak usage hours. Pricing & Subscription
Subscription is typically tied to "VIP status" on the IPTorrents site. As of the latest community reports:
Base Cost: Approximately $10/month (often through a donation) for VIP status, which includes 2 concurrent streams.
Additional Streams: Extra streams can be added for roughly $9/month each.
IP Restriction: Note that concurrent streams usually must originate from the same IP address; watching from multiple locations simultaneously may result in a temporary lockout. Technical Setup Tips
To get the most out of the service, experienced users recommend avoiding the native EPG and using third-party tools:
Use an External EPG: Tools like m3u4u allow you to map the IPT channel lineup to a more reliable guide for free.
Recommended Players: TiviMate is the top recommendation for Android TV devices, while Kodi or GSE Smart IPTV are popular for other platforms.
VPN Requirement: Using a VPN is highly recommended to mask streaming activity from ISPs and avoid potential regional blocks. Pros and Cons Pros High uptime and stream stability Native EPG is often considered "trash" Included as a VIP perk for members Strict 1-IP rule for standard multi-streams Massive global channel selection Invitation-only access to the platform
Verdict: IPTorrents IPTV is an excellent, low-cost option for existing members who already use the tracker. However, for those looking for a "plug-and-play" experience with a functional guide out of the box, the required technical configuration (like setting up m3u4u) might be a hurdle.

IPTorrents (IPT) is legendary in the private tracker world as a robust 0-day general tracker. While most members flock there for movie and software torrents, its internal IPTV service has become a polarizing topic among streaming enthusiasts. If you are looking for a stable alternative to standard commercial IPTV providers, this review explores whether IPTorrents IPTV is worth your donation. What is IPTorrents IPTV?
Unlike standalone providers like Stream4K or Xtreme HD, IPTorrents IPTV is an exclusive service offered directly to members of the IPTorrents private tracker. It functions as a traditional IPTV service, delivering live sports, entertainment, and news channels over the internet, often utilized via players like TiviMate or VLC. Pricing and Subscription Structure
The pricing for IPTorrents IPTV is tied to the tracker’s "VIP" status rather than a standard checkout page.
Base Cost: $10 per month is required as a donation to gain VIP status, which includes access to the IPTV service. Streams: The base donation provides 2 concurrent streams.
Additional Streams: Extra streams can be added for approximately $9 per month each.
IP Restriction: Note that the two standard streams must typically originate from a single IP address; watching from two different locations simultaneously may result in a temporary lockout. Core Features and Performance
Stability: Users frequently report that IPTorrents IPTV is more stable than many "public" IPTV providers. Many long-term users claim they experience zero buffering, even during high-traffic live events.
Channel Selection: It offers a wide range of international channels, including major USA, UK, and Canadian networks.
VOD Content: In addition to live TV, the service includes Movies and TV On Demand (VOD) libraries.
Compatibility: The service works across multiple platforms, though users highly recommend using TiviMate on Android TV or Kodi on PC for the best experience. Pros and Cons: Is it Worth It? Pros Cons
High Reliability: Less prone to "exit scams" since it's tied to a massive private community.
Higher Price Point: At $10/month for only 2 streams, it is more expensive than bulk providers like PioneersTV.
Excellent for Sports: Stable streams during major matches with minimal lag.
Poor Native EPG: The built-in Electronic Program Guide is often described as "trash".
VIP Benefits: The donation also grants you VIP status on the tracker, which helps maintain your download ratio.
Limited Support: Support is handled through tracker forums rather than a dedicated 24/7 chat. Expert Tips for Success This is where the distinction matters
Use m3u4u for EPG: Since the default IPT program guide is unreliable, many users use m3u4u to organize their channel list and pull in better guide data.
Privacy is Key: Even though IPT is a private community, your ISP can still see your traffic. Experts on Reddit and YouTube recommend using a VPN like ExpressVPN to prevent throttling.
Ratio Management: If you are new to the tracker, remember that you must maintain a ratio of at least 0.96 for your torrents, though the $10 donation for IPTV can help mitigate ratio issues by providing upload credit. The Verdict
IPTorrents IPTV is a "premium" choice for those who value stability over the lowest price. If you are already a member of the tracker and need a reliable backup or primary source for live TV that won't vanish overnight, the $10 donation is a solid investment. However, if you need 5+ streams for a large household, you might find better value with standalone providers like CatchOn TV. Are you currently a member of IPTorrents, or IPTorrents
IPTorrents (IPT) is primarily one of the world's largest and most well-known private torrent trackers, rather than a dedicated Internet Protocol television (IPTV) provider. However, many users specifically search for reviews on how it integrates with streaming workflows. The IPTorrents Experience
Unlike public sites, IPT is invite-only and maintains a strict ratio system. For those looking for TV content, it serves as a high-quality source for:
Automated TV Series: Many users pair IPT with software like Sonarr or Radarr to create a "pseudo-IPTV" experience, where shows are downloaded automatically in high definition as soon as they air.
Full Season Packs: It is highly rated for finding entire seasons of older shows in consistent quality, something often missing from live IPTV services.
Reliability: Because it is a private community, the files are generally free of the malware often found on public trackers. IPT vs. Traditional IPTV
If you are looking for live channels (sports, news, or international cable), a standard IPTV subscription is likely what you need.
Live vs. On-Demand: IPT is strictly for downloading files (On-Demand). Traditional IPTV providers like Nigma TV offer live streams.
Hardware Requirements: To watch IPT content comfortably on a TV, you typically need a media server like Plex or Jellyfin. Traditional IPTV usually runs through apps like IPTV Smarters Pro. Critical Considerations
Safety and Privacy: Using any unauthorized streaming or torrenting service carries risks, including data breaches or identity theft. A VPN is considered mandatory by the community for both torrenting on IPT and using third-party IPTV.
Maintenance: IPT requires you to "seed" (upload) what you download. If you don't maintain a good ratio, your account will be banned.
